Hydrophobic coating

Hydrophobic coatings make it easier to remove spots and dirt from surfaces like metal, glass and plastic. They can also protect surfaces from damage caused by moisture and enhance their the durability of surfaces. They are often employed on outdoor surfaces, and they can cut down on cleaning costs and time. They can also help prevent rust and corrosion and provide UV protection.

Hydrophobic paints are smooth surfaces that repel water molecules. These coatings are usually made from fluoropolymers, including pol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), better known as Teflon. These substances have a high lubricity and a slick feel. They are able to be used on metals, glass, and textiles. The manufacturers determine the hydrophobicity of a material by putting a droplet on its surface and measuring the contact angle. Super-hydrophobic coatings have a contact angle greater than 150 degrees.

Secure windows

While the majority of the security industry's focus is on doors and locks but burglars also have the ability to gain entry through windows. Two out of three burglaries that occur in America involve windows.

There are a variety of ways you can make your windows more secure. This includes installing window bars, which can keep burglars out of your home through the windows and are available in a variety of styles. They also give a feeling of privacy without compromising your view.

Another option is to use glass that has been tempered. It is more durable and safer than ordinary annealed glass. When glass is broken it, it breaks into tiny, harmless pieces, instead of sharp dangerous fragments. This kind of glass also helps to reduce the likelihood of injury from windows that have been broken, especially during an event of natural disaster or break-in.
